Oyster fungus, Himley Plantation and Bantock Park

Oyster fungus, Himley Plantation

Oyster fungus, a gilled fungus usually found growing from the trunks or stumps of trees, and sometimes also found on supermarket shelves. These were growing on a tree trunk in Himley Plantation and a decaying fallen trunk in Bantock Park.

Old man’s beard, seed ripening, Bridgnorth

Old man's beard, seed ripening, Bridgnorth

Old man’s beard seed beginning to ripen, not yet developing the whispy white fronds which give the plant its name.

Old man's beard, seed ripening, Bridgnorth

A climbing plant sometimes found covering hedges, it also grows abundantly on the face of the cliff by the river at Bridgnorth.

Season of mists: Avon at Stratford, early morning

Season of mists: Avon at Stratford, early morning

Views across the River Avon at Stratford, looking towards Holy Trinity church downstream or the tramway bridge upstream. A thin mist rising from the water.

Season of mists: Avon at Stratford, early morning

Pictures taken just before and just after sunrise. I like the period in the weeks immediately after the clocks go back. The photography-friendly early morning light is not too early, but still early enough that the only people about are those hurrying to work.
